Whether there for business or pleasure, there’s a reason so many people are entranced by the city of Amsterdam. With the plethora of curated vintage boutiques, corner cafes, museums and galleries—all with those coveted canal views—Amsterdam can feel like you just walked into a storybook. Here, discerning locals and frequent flyers share some of their favorite hidden gems. From vintage denim shops to some of the best dining in the city, you’ll want to add all of these to your itinerary during your next buying trip to Amsterdam.

Cafe-Restaurant Amsterdam
“Confusingly, this restaurant is called Cafe-Restaurant Amsterdam but it’s a beautiful, industrial space with great food that’s well worth the long, annoying google search. It used to be a water distributor, and the old tiles, industrial pumps and fixtures take center stage in the engine room restaurant.”
